+Go on iOS
+=========
+
+To run the standard library tests, run all.bash as usual, but with the compiler
+set to the clang wrapper that invokes clang for iOS. For example, this command runs
+ all.bash on the iOS emulator:
+
+ GOOS=ios GOARCH=amd64 CGO_ENABLED=1 CC_FOR_TARGET=$(pwd)/../misc/ios/clangwrap.sh ./all.bash
+
+If CC_FOR_TARGET is not set when the toolchain is built (make.bash or all.bash), CC
+can be set on the command line. For example,
+
+ GOOS=ios GOARCH=amd64 CGO_ENABLED=1 CC=$(go env GOROOT)/misc/ios/clangwrap.sh go build
+
+Setting CC is not necessary if the toolchain is built with CC_FOR_TARGET set.
+
+To use the go tool to run individual programs and tests, put $GOROOT/bin into PATH to ensure
+the go_ios_$GOARCH_exec wrapper is found. For example, to run the archive/tar tests:
+
+ export PATH=$GOROOT/bin:$PATH
+ GOOS=ios GOARCH=amd64 CGO_ENABLED=1 go test archive/tar
+
+The go_ios_exec wrapper uses GOARCH to select the emulator (amd64) or the device (arm64).
+However, further setup is required to run tests or programs directly on a device.
+
+First make sure you have a valid developer certificate and have setup your device properly
+to run apps signed by your developer certificate. Then install the libimobiledevice and
+ideviceinstaller tools from https://www.libimobiledevice.org/. Use the HEAD versions from
+source; the stable versions have bugs that prevents the Go exec wrapper to install and run
+apps.
+
+Second, the Go exec wrapper must be told the developer account signing identity, the team
+id and a provisioned bundle id to use. They're specified with the environment variables
+GOIOS_DEV_ID, GOIOS_TEAM_ID and GOIOS_APP_ID. The detect.go program in this directory will
+attempt to auto-detect suitable values. Run it as
+
+ go run detect.go
+
+which will output something similar to
+
+ export GOIOS_DEV_ID="iPhone Developer: xxx@yyy.zzz (XXXXXXXX)"
+ export GOIOS_APP_ID=YYYYYYYY.some.bundle.id
+ export GOIOS_TEAM_ID=ZZZZZZZZ
+
+If you have multiple devices connected, specify the device UDID with the GOIOS_DEVICE_ID
+variable. Use `idevice_id -l` to list all available UDIDs. Then, setting GOARCH to arm64
+will select the device:
+
+ GOOS=ios GOARCH=arm64 CGO_ENABLED=1 CC_FOR_TARGET=$(pwd)/../misc/ios/clangwrap.sh ./all.bash
+
+Note that the go_darwin_$GOARCH_exec wrapper uninstalls any existing app identified by
+the bundle id before installing a new app. If the uninstalled app is the last app by
+the developer identity, the device might also remove the permission to run apps from
+that developer, and the exec wrapper will fail to install the new app. To avoid that,
+install another app with the same developer identity but with a different bundle id.
+That way, the permission to install apps is held on to while the primary app is
+uninstalled.

+#!/bin/sh
+# This uses the latest available iOS SDK, which is recommended.
+# To select a specific SDK, run 'xcodebuild -showsdks'
+# to see the available SDKs and replace iphoneos with one of them.
+if [ "$GOARCH" == "arm64" ]; then
+ SDK=iphoneos
+ PLATFORM=ios
+ CLANGARCH="arm64"
+else
+ SDK=iphonesimulator
+ PLATFORM=ios-simulator
+ CLANGARCH="x86_64"
+fi
+
+SDK_PATH=`xcrun --sdk $SDK --show-sdk-path`
+export IPHONEOS_DEPLOYMENT_TARGET=5.1
+# cmd/cgo doesn't support llvm-gcc-4.2, so we have to use clang.
+CLANG=`xcrun --sdk $SDK --find clang`
+
+exec "$CLANG" -arch $CLANGARCH -isysroot "$SDK_PATH" -m${PLATFORM}-version-min=10.0 "$@"

+// Copyright 2015 The Go Authors. All rights reserved.
+// Use of this source code is governed by a BSD-style
+// license that can be found in the LICENSE file.
+
+// +build ignore
+
+// detect attempts to autodetect the correct
+// values of the environment variables
+// used by go_ios_exec.
+// detect shells out to ideviceinfo, a third party program that can
+// be obtained by following the instructions at
+// https://github.com/libimobiledevice/libimobiledevice.
+package main
+
+import (
+ "bytes"
+ "crypto/x509"
+ "fmt"
+ "os"
+ "os/exec"
+ "strings"
+)
+
+func main() {
+ udids := getLines(exec.Command("idevice_id", "-l"))
+ if len(udids) == 0 {
+ fail("no udid found; is a device connected?")
+ }
+
+ mps := detectMobileProvisionFiles(udids)
+ if len(mps) == 0 {
+ fail("did not find mobile provision matching device udids %q", udids)
+ }
+
+ fmt.Println("# Available provisioning profiles below.")
+ fmt.Println("# NOTE: Any existing app on the device with the app id specified by GOIOS_APP_ID")
+ fmt.Println("# will be overwritten when running Go programs.")
+ for _, mp := range mps {
+ fmt.Println()
+ f, err := os.CreateTemp("", "go_ios_detect_")
+ check(err)
+ fname := f.Name()
+ defer os.Remove(fname)
+
+ out := output(parseMobileProvision(mp))
+ _, err = f.Write(out)
+ check(err)
+ check(f.Close())
+
+ cert, err := plistExtract(fname, "DeveloperCertificates:0")
+ check(err)
+ pcert, err := x509.ParseCertificate(cert)
+ check(err)
+ fmt.Printf("export GOIOS_DEV_ID=\"%s\"\n", pcert.Subject.CommonName)
+
+ appID, err := plistExtract(fname, "Entitlements:application-identifier")
+ check(err)
+ fmt.Printf("export GOIOS_APP_ID=%s\n", appID)
+
+ teamID, err := plistExtract(fname, "Entitlements:com.apple.developer.team-identifier")
+ check(err)
+ fmt.Printf("export GOIOS_TEAM_ID=%s\n", teamID)
+ }
+}
+
+func detectMobileProvisionFiles(udids [][]byte) []string {
+ cmd := exec.Command("mdfind", "-name", ".mobileprovision")
+ lines := getLines(cmd)
+
+ var files []string
+ for _, line := range lines {
+ if len(line) == 0 {
+ continue
+ }
+ xmlLines := getLines(parseMobileProvision(string(line)))
+ matches := 0
+ for _, udid := range udids {
+ for _, xmlLine := range xmlLines {
+ if bytes.Contains(xmlLine, udid) {
+ matches++
+ }
+ }
+ }
+ if matches == len(udids) {
+ files = append(files, string(line))
+ }
+ }
+ return files
+}
+
+func parseMobileProvision(fname string) *exec.Cmd {
+ return exec.Command("security", "cms", "-D", "-i", string(fname))
+}
+
+func plistExtract(fname string, path string) ([]byte, error) {
+ out, err := exec.Command("/usr/libexec/PlistBuddy", "-c", "Print "+path, fname).CombinedOutput()
+ if err != nil {
+ return nil, err
+ }
+ return bytes.TrimSpace(out), nil
+}
+
+func getLines(cmd *exec.Cmd) [][]byte {
+ out := output(cmd)
+ lines := bytes.Split(out, []byte("\n"))
+ // Skip the empty line at the end.
+ if len(lines[len(lines)-1]) == 0 {
+ lines = lines[:len(lines)-1]
+ }
+ return lines
+}
+
+func output(cmd *exec.Cmd) []byte {
+ out, err := cmd.Output()
+ if err != nil {
+ fmt.Println(strings.Join(cmd.Args, "\n"))
+ f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, err)
+ os.Exit(1)
+ }
+ return out
+}
+
+func check(err error) {
+ if err != nil {
+ fail(err.Error())
+ }
+}
+
+func fail(msg string, v ...interface{}) {
+ fmt.Fprintf(os.Stderr, msg, v...)
+ f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r)
+ os.Exit(1)
+}
